About Signs of Sobriety – Ewing Township

Signs of Sobriety provides support for substance abuse recovery for the deaf and hard of hearing residents of New Jersey. Signs of Sobriety services include communication access and interpreting for Twelve Step Meetings.

Signs of Sobriety believes in recovery through retreats, and recreational events along with support groups, and counseling. At Signs of Sobriety, they will also focus on sobriety maintenance, health care, diet, and developing relationship and parenting skills.

Signs of Sobriety provides support for family members, friends and also coworkers if it is needed. They also promote Sober Houses for people in recovery so they can begin a new, sober, life. Sings of Sobriety looks forward to empower the Deaf and Hard-of-Hearing population by reducing risk factors that lead to alcohol or drug addiction.

Adult Program

Adult rehab programs include therapies tailored to each client's specific needs, goals, and recovery progress. They are tailored to the specific challenges adult clients may face, including family and work pressures and commitments. From inpatient and residential treatment to various levels of outpatient services, there are many options available. Some facilities also help adults work through co-occurring conditions, like anxiety, that can accompany addiction.

Young Adult Program

Young adulthood can be an exciting, yet difficult, time of transition. Individuals in their late teens to mid-20s face unique stressors related to school, jobs, families, and social circles, which can lead to a rise in substance use. Rehab centers with dedicated young adult programs will include activities and amenities that cater to this age group, with an emphasis on specialized counseling, peer socialization, and ongoing aftercare.
